The first fragrance I wanted to review is Coconut and Cotton. Like with all the fragrance I purchased, I really liked this fragrance in store, but I didn’t know if I would like it once I tried to wear it in my daily life.
According to Bath and Body Work’s website, the fragrance’s scent is described as…
What it smells like: laundry day on the islands.
Fragrance notes: coconut, coastal breeze and beachside cotton.
The fragrance is a light fragrance with tropical scent notes. To me, the scent reminds me of a bedroom with fresh, clean sheets that looks out onto a beach with coconut palm trees all around. I really like the scent a lot, and enjoy smelling it, but for me, wearing it was not as easy as I thought it would be.
Since the website for the fragrance describes what it smells like as “laundry day on the islands”, it was hard for me to enjoy wearing the fragrance as a fragrance on my body. When I wrote it as a fragrance on me, it smelled like I got finished with the laundry and sprayed a coconut scented body spray or fine fragrance mist on me. It didn’t make me think I was a person on a beach surrounded by clean, fresh laundry. It made me think I was someone who finished doing laundry on a beach.
My major problem with the fragrance it that my mist is meant to be worn on the body, not as a home fragrance such as a Wallflower or room spray. It would be perfect for me to use around the house. If I purchased it in that version, I would enjoy it even more. Unfortunately, I own it in the fine fragrance mist version.
I really like this fragrance because it is light, easy to smell, lasts more than two hours on the skin, and is perfect for spring and summer months, but I highly recommend considering if you will like this fragrance on your body or as a home fragrance. If you want to own the fragrance but cannot find it as a Wallflower or room spray, then you can use the fine fragrance mist as a spray for fabrics, such as bedding and pillows. Since I like the scent as a home scent than a body scent, I sometimes like to use the spray on fabrics to make the smell nice.
